kathy is baking cakes.each cake requires 1/12 of a teaspoon of vanilla and she has 9/12 of a teaspoon,how much cakes can she bake

Answer:

You need to divide the total teaspoons she has by the amount she needs for each cake to find out how many cakes she can bake. 9/12 / 1/12 =9 She can bake 9 cakes.
